WebWhat is ChIP-seq? ChIP-seq is short for chromatin immunoprecipitation-sequencing. Fundamentally, ChIP-seq is the sequencing of the genomic DNA fragments that co-precipitate with a DNA-binding protein that is under study. The DNA-binding proteins most frequently investigated in this way are transcription factors (for example, p53 or NFκB), ... WebHOMER was initially developed to automate the process of finding enriched motifs in ChIP-Seq peaks. More generally, HOMER analyzes genomic positions, not limited to only ChIP-Seq peaks, for enriched motifs. The main idea is that all the user really needs is a file containing genomic coordinates (i.e. a HOMER peak file or BED file), and HOMER ...

Chromatin immunoprecipitation followed by sequencing (ChIP-seq) is an important tool for studying gene regulatory proteins, such as transcription factors and histones. Peak calling is one of the first steps in the analysis of these data.
